RE: The price spike today... Regardless of the reason behind it or whether or not the SEC would/will investigate (much less act), it was a VERY painful lesson about penny stocks to those that bought at/near the high. One needs to think long and hard before they decide to play in this segment of the market where TRUE DD (due diligence) is nearly impossible and MM (market makers) are looking out after THEIR best interest.

When there are wild rides like today, we poor slobs w/o real time quote capacity are at a real disadvantage when we rely on brokers 20 min or so delayed quotes. I have found a partial solution if you use E*trade:

1. Go to "Enter STOCK ORDER"
2. Enter the info into the data fields
3. Click "Preview Order"

You will get a very close estimate of what the results would be if you executed the trade via E*Trade. I'm not sure how much more current the bid/ask is, but it seems more recent info than you get from their 20 min delay.

IMPORTANT CAVEAT!!!!

DO NOT, I REPEAT DO NOT make the mistake of hitting the button at the bottom that actually executes the trade!!! I put my arrow at the top of my screen on my back button to avoid that error ever since I almost bought 1000 shares of Netscape by accident.
